Key Features of Adobe Dimension for Mac
1. Intuitive User Interface
Dimension is easy to get up and running with. It’s straightforward to use, with an intuitive user-interface that is deceptively clever. It is designed for the lay user in 3D. It has an intuitive interface and tools that work as you would expect. The setup of Dimension is very drag-and-drop, making scene setup quick and easy.
2. Realistic 3D Rendering
Another of Dimension’s big selling points is its capacity for creating photorealistic 3D renders. Its rendering engine is built to produce hyper-realistic graphics, with visible lighting and shadows, that can look just like photographs, and the product, if it exists, is not required for the photographer.
Dimension also comes with ‘ray-tracing’ as a way of simulating how light interacts with surfaces – a feature that instantly makes your renders look polished and believable. It’s perfect for designers who create product packaging or advertising mockups, though its powers will impress users of almost any project.
3. Extensive Library of Assets
Adobe Dimension includes a library of assets to speed up your designs. You have access to a large selection of pre-built 3D models, textures and materials. A lot of these are themed, so there’s a whole area dedicated to create 3D views of bottles and boxes. There’s also an entire section for furniture, and yet another for abstract shapes. So, you probably won’t have a need to import any third-party assets into Dimension to create professional looking visuals.
Meanwhile, the Adobe Stock integration lets you search for and insert even more assets in your project while you work. You’ll be able to find precisely the model or texture you’re looking for to complete your creative vision.
4. Material and Texture Editing
Controlling materials and textures is one of the most important elements in creating realistic-looking 3D visuals, and Adobe Dimension makes it easy and effective. You can add different materials, such as glass, wood, metal or rubber, to your model with just a few clicks. Each material can be customized; for example, you can control how reflective, rough or translucent the material is.
But in the Material Editor you have complete control over how a material is rendered – you can fine-tune how it looks and responds to different kinds of light. 5. Lighting and Environment Controls
Adobe Dimension offers a variety of lighting and environmental controls that help you achieve the mood you want to set for your 3D scene. You can use HDRI (High Dynamic Range Images) to set up realistic environmental lighting, making your models appear as though they belong in the real world.
You can adjust the intensity, rotation and colour of your lighting and create a natural scene with shadows and highlights, where some parts are bright and others are dark. You can add endless lights, such as point lights, spot lights, and directional lights, so that you can put accent on a certain part of your design or your project.

7. Camera Controls and Perspectives
Consider powerful camera controls in Adobe Dimension, which allow you to experiment with the view and settle on the right perspective and angle for your scene. Orbit, pan and dolly controls let you move around your models, finding the right view of the finished product for your render. This is especially helpful for product mockups or marketing imagery, where presentation is everything.
You can save out multiple camera views, too, which is helpful when you want to experiment with composition and figure out which angle best suits your design. Dial in some depth of field settings and you can even blur out the background for a professional look, making certain objects (aka your scene) the focal point.
8. 2D and 3D Design Combinations
Combining 2D and 3D elements is one of the coolest things you can do in Adobe Dimension. You can use 2D vector graphics as decals, textures and labels to give flat graphics a sense of depth and realism in your product mockups.
This ability to mix 2D and 3D elements opens up possibilities to add more dynamism and create more interesting designs, whether you’re working on a simple product label or a full-scale marketing campaign. 10. File Compatibility and Export Options
Adobe Dimension is compatible with many file formats, which means you can bring in assets from all kinds of creators. Whether you import a model from popular formats such as OBJ, FBX, STL or more, Dimension offers flexibility to work with almost any 3D asset.
As export time approaches, Dimension has a selection of formats, including PNG, PSD and 3D file formats. It even has the option to export renders with transparent backgrounds to be used in composites or marketing materials.

Tips for Getting the Most Out of Adobe Dimension
Playing with Lighting: Lighting is the most important aspect of a 3D scene. Experiment with different lighting setups and see how changing the lighting affects the mood and realism of the rendering.
Explore Adobe Stock Assets: Access the Adobe Stock library for more models and textures to give your project the perfect look.
Mixing 2D and 3D Elements: Take the 2D graphics from your stock image and bring them into your 3D scene. This is particularly useful when creating product mockups and branding visualizations.
Try Different Camera Angles: Save multiple camera views to explore different angles and choose the best one to showcase your design.
Manipulate Materials: Use the Material Editor to play around with the appearance of your surfaces. Change the roughness and reflectance to get the look you’re after.
